"Cam Search Yolobit jpg" represents a specialized intersection of computer vision technology and remote camera monitoring systems . While the exact term often appears in technical forums and developer repositories, it typically refers to a workflow where a YOLO-based algorithm scans a live camera feed to detect specific objects and saves those detections as .jpg image files for search or archival.
